Atlantic American (NASDAQ:AAME) Stock Crosses Above Two Hundred Day Moving Average – Here’s What Happened

Atlantic American Co. (NASDAQ:AAMEGet Free Report)’s stock price crossed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Friday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of $1.59 and traded as high as $1.64. Atlantic American shares last traded at $1.57, with a volume of 1,311 shares.

Atlantic American Stock Performance

The firm has a market cap of $32.03 million, a PE ratio of -4.49 and a beta of 0.47. The firm’s 50-day moving average price is $1.56 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$1.59.

Hedge Funds Weigh In On Atlantic American

A hedge fund recently raised its stake in Atlantic American stock. Biglari Sardar grew its position in shares of Atlantic American Co. (NASDAQ:AAMEFree Report) by 17.9% in the third qu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 188,393 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after buying an additional 28,633 shares during the quarter. Atlantic American accounts for 0.7% of Biglari Sardar’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 10th largest holding. Biglari Sardar owned 0.92% of Atlantic American worth $320,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period. 5.48% of the stock is ow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

Atlantic American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ides life and health, and property and casualty insurance products in the United States. It operates through American Southern and Bankers Fidelity segments. The company offers property and casualty insurance products, including commercial automobile insurance coverage for state governments, local municipalities, and other motor pools and fleets; general liability; and inland marine insurance products.
